A very large beautiful Egyptian pre-dynastic black top pottery vessel, re-joined from 12 original fragments. Comes with featured custom display stand. Very rare to find in such a large size. Black-mouth pots were
produced during the Naqada I period and are
characterized by a dark band around their rim.
The remainder of the exterior surface is coloured red
with haematite, while the interior is entirely black. This
